Chile`s carbon capture and sequestration market are gaining traction as the country seeks to address climate change and reduce carbon emissions. With a growing awareness of environmental issues, industries are increasingly adopting carbon capture and sequestration technologies to mitigate their carbon footprints. The market is driven by government initiatives, incentives, and investments in clean energy solutions. Chile`s abundant natural resources, including suitable geological formations for carbon storage, further bolster market growth. As Chile aims to transition to a low-carbon economy, the carbon capture and sequestration market present significant opportunities for investors and technology developers.
The drive to mitigate climate change and reduce carbon emissions is the primary driver of the carbon capture and sequestration market in Chile. As the country aims to meet its environmental commitments and transition to cleaner energy sources, there`s a growing focus on technologies that can capture and store carbon dioxide emitted from industrial processes and power plants. Government incentives, coupled with corporate initiatives to achieve carbon neutrality, are driving investments in carbon capture and sequestration projects.
The Carbon Capture and Sequestration (CCS) market in Chile face several challenges, primarily related to high costs and technological limitations. Implementing CCS technology requires significant capital investment, and the lack of financial incentives or supportive policies can deter companies from investing in such projects. Additionally, identifying suitable sites for carbon storage and addressing potential environmental risks associated with CCS operations are significant challenges that need to be addressed to promote the widespread adoption of CCS technology in Chile.
Government policies pertaining to the carbon capture and sequestration market in Chile focus on incentivizing investment in CCS projects, promoting research and development in carbon capture technologies, and establishing regulatory frameworks for CO2 storage and transportation. Additionally, the government works closely with industry stakeholders to identify suitable sites for carbon storage and facilitate the deployment of CCS infrastructure.
